Chic and rebellious women’s cargo shorts with chain
Techwear cargo shorts that transpose urban codes into a mid-length format. The loose silhouette, detachable silver chain, and utility straps immediately set the tone: an assertive piece, designed for those who embrace an uncompromising streetwear wardrobe.
The construction relies on a smooth, fluid-drape fabric, cut in a wide fit above the knee. The full elastic waistband offers a flexible fit without visible drawstring closure, keeping the front line clean. The side cargo pockets are structured with a gusset, closed by a flap with a black clip buckle and completed with metal D-rings. The hanging straps extend the silhouette downwards, while the double silver chain hooks onto the front belt loop to sign off the techwear vibe. The side seams remain clean, and the bottom hems are simple and straight.

Technical Specs & Benefits
- Pockets: two side gusseted cargo pockets with flap and clip buckle, plus side-entry pockets.
- Details: clean straight hems, reinforced side seams, D-rings, and removable chain.
- Material: 97% polyester / 3% spandex.
- Color: Deep black.
